Anyone heard anything about the picture project returning (specifically to LCF)? Heard that rumor :)

KSguy
09-25-2003, 10:41 PM
It is being considered.

It was discontinued because of a system-wide policy by the last Secretary of Corrections.

So, in order for it to come back it has to be done state-wide. That requires ALL of the wardens of all of the Kansas institutions to agree on how it will be handled this time, etc.

There were problems with how the last picture project was supervised...so it's a planning process right now figuring out how to make it better.

From what I hear, the responses from the wardens across the state have been positive for brining it back. That's not a guarantee, but it does give some hope.

But you're dealing with the state here...meetings, requisitions, more meetings...so nothing is going to happen "immediately".

DOC Central Office has approved the return of "the picture project." This approval only came down recently. It is now up to each individual facility to put a "plan" into place to accomodate photos. Each facility has the option of not doing it at all, but I'm assuming most will do it because of the interest.

It will take a few weeks for each facility to plan out it's strategy before getting it back up.

The project will not be too much different than the way it was ran before. The following rules will apply...

1. Only level three inmates will be eligible to have their photos taken.

2. Only one inmate may be in a photo at a time. No group photos.

3. In order to sign up for the photo, the inmate must sign a waiver stating the photo is for "private" use of someone on his approved visiting list and will not be publicly displayed. If the visitor uses the photo for any other reason, his/her visiting is subject to suspension. If it is found that the inmate conspired in the publishing of the photo, he can be subject to a disciplinary report.

4. Photos can only be delivered to an approved visitor.
